About Howard Dublin

Howard Dublin is a modestly rated but responsible site manager. Across their buildings, tenants rate them 2.6/5 across 4 reviews, with 0% recommending their buildings and 0% approving of them as an owner or associate. Their portfolio records 1 eviction, 6 open violations, and 5 litigation cases. Data last updated July 28, 2026. Howard Dublin is a site manager associated with 1 building and 41 units across Kew Gardens in Queens. The portfolio is concentrated in Kew Gardens in Queens. The building was constructed in 1939 and is primarily mid-rise. All of the associated units have rent-stabilized apartments. Former tenant·Over 2 years ago

Quality of building decline

Pros

Spacious rooms and building surrounded by a scenic residential area.

Cons

Response from owner is very poor, too many issues with leaks and old pipes. Management is very slow to make improvements to apartments and issues around the building. Sometimes takes months to half a year or more to fix issues. Pest issue (roaches) is bad and can be seen in common areas of building such as lobby, laundry room and elevator. Many people with roaches in their apartments too. Building needs better management to improve quality

Advice to the owners

Owner needs to take better care of issues in the building. Used to be a beautiful building, not it has gone downhill and many people aren’t happy with the quality of the building.

Open violations

From past 10 years · Updated 5 days ago

Average violations per unit for this owner or associate is better than the city average.

Owner average0.14Violations per unit
NYC average0.81Violations per unit
3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

0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

3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
